Klung Kung

Klungkung is the smallest regency in the Bali province. This busy market town on the main route to Besakih and Amlapura is steeped in history and has some noteworthy sites. August 17th: Indonesia’s Independence Day!

The Indonesian Independence day is celebrated to a lesser extent in Bali than in the rest of Indonesia, but especially in the larger towns you have a good chance of experiencing celebrations.   Independence Day is celebrated on August 17.
